加入收藏 | 设为首页 | 会员中心 | 我要投稿 91站长网 (https://www.91zhanzhang.com/)- 机器学习、操作系统、大数据、低代码、数据湖!
当前位置: 首页 > 站长学院 > PHP教程 > 正文

初识PHP:正则表达式基础及实战应用解析

发布时间:2025-08-01 15:19:40 所属栏目:PHP教程 来源:DaWei
导读: PHP 中的正则表达式是一种强大的工具,用于匹配、查找和替换字符串中的特定模式。它基于 POSIX 标准,提供了丰富的元字符和函数来处理文本。 常用的正则表达式函数包括 preg_match、preg_match_all 和 preg

PHP 中的正则表达式是一种强大的工具,用于匹配、查找和替换字符串中的特定模式。它基于 POSIX 标准,提供了丰富的元字符和函数来处理文本。


常用的正则表达式函数包括 preg_match、preg_match_all 和 preg_replace。这些函数分别用于单次匹配、多次匹配以及替换匹配内容。使用时需注意正则表达式的格式,通常以斜杠包裹。


图画AI生成,仅供参考

元字符如 ^、$、.、、+ 等在正则中起到关键作用。例如,^ 表示开头,$ 表示结尾,. 匹配任意字符, 表示前一个字符出现零次或多次。合理运用这些符号可以构建复杂的匹配规则。


在实际开发中,正则常用于表单验证、数据提取和文本处理。比如验证邮箱格式、提取网页中的链接或替换敏感词。编写正则时应注重效率和可读性,避免过于复杂导致性能下降。


使用正则时要注意转义字符的问题,某些特殊字符需要加反斜杠进行转义。同时,PHP 的 PCRE 扩展支持更高级的功能,如分组和捕获,为复杂操作提供更多可能性。

(编辑:91站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章